The Power of Love

Love is one of the most potent and transformative forces in human experience. Its impact stretches far beyond just personal relationships, shaping societies, influencing actions, and providing the foundation for growth and healing. Whether romantic, familial, or platonic, love is essential to our emotional well-being and plays a significant role in how we relate to others and the world around us.


At its core, love is a deep connection between individuals, rooted in trust, empathy and understanding. It is not just a feeling, but a powerful bond that transcends time, distance, and even conflict. Love motivates people to act selflessly, to offer support, and to stand by one another during both good times and hardships. It is in the quiet moments of care, the small gestures of kindness, and the sacrifices made for others that love reveals its true power.


Biologically, love triggers the release of hormones like oxytocin and dopamine, which promote happiness, attachment, and a sense of fulfillment. These neurochemical reactions show that love isn't just an abstract concept; it has a real and measurable impact on our health and well-being. Studies have shown that people in loving relationships tend to experience less stress, improved mental health and a stronger sense of belonging.


On a societal level, love is the driving force behind many movements for justice, equality, and peace. From civil rights leaders like Martin Luther King Jr. to humanitarian figures like Mother Teresa, love has served as the cornerstone of efforts aimed at transforming society for the better. Love fosters empathy, helping individuals look beyond differences and work toward common goals. It encourages cooperation, compassion and understanding in ways that words alone cannot.


In times of adversity, love also proves its resilience. Whether in personal struggles or global challenges, the support that love provides can be a source of strength and perseverance. The people who share and receive love during difficult times often find the courage to endure, knowing they are not alone.


Ultimately, the power of love lies in its ability to connect people, heal emotional wounds and inspire positive change. It is a force that shapes the way we view the world and the way we treat each other, making life richer, fuller and more meaningful. In every expression of love, we find a glimpse of the extraordinary potential for goodness, unity and transformation within humanity.
